This beginner friendly workshop introduces attendees to the fundamentals of C++ programming. Attendees will explore basic variable types, data structures like array and vectors, and learn to write functions. By the end, participants will be able to create simple C++ programs and a foundation for advanced topics.

Learning Outcomes:

  • Understand and use basic C++ variable types.
  • Implement arrays and vectors.
  • Write functions to organize and use code.
  • Compile and run C++ successfully.

This is the first workshop in a 3-part series.

Note: We will use Google Colab to write and compile C++ code during the workshop. Please ensure you have an active Google account for this session.
